mirror of
https://github.com/GSA/notifications-admin.git
synced 2026-02-05 10:53:28 -05:00
…or how to move a bunch of things from a bunch of different places into `app/static`. There are three main reasons not to use Flask Assets: - It had some strange behaviour like only - It was based on Ruby SASS, which is slower to get new features than libsass, and meant depending on Ruby, and having the SASS Gem globally installed—so you’re already out of being a ‘pure’ Python app - Martyn and I have experience of doing it this way on Marketplace, and we’ve ironed out the initial rough patches The specific technologies this introduces, all of which are Node-based: - Gulp – like a Makefile written in Javascript - NPM – package management, used for managing Gulp and its related dependencies - Bower – also package management, and the only way I can think to have GOV.UK template as a proper dependency …speaking of which, GOV.UK template is now a dependency. This means it can’t be modified at all (eg to add a global `#content` wrapper), so every page now inherits from a template that has this wrapper. But it also means that we have a clean upgrade path when the template is modified. Everything else (toolkit, elements) I’ve kept as submodules but moved them to a more logical place (`app/assets` not `app/assets/stylesheets`, because they contain more than just SASS/CSS).
33 lines
837 B
HTML
33 lines
837 B
HTML
{% extends "admin_template.html" %}
|
|
{% from "components/form-field.html" import render_field %}
|
|
|
|
{% block page_title %}
|
|
GOV.UK Notify | Set up service
|
|
{% endblock %}
|
|
|
|
{% block fullwidth_content %}
|
|
|
|
<div class="grid-row">
|
|
<div class="column-two-thirds">
|
|
<h1 class="heading-xlarge">Set up notifications for your service</h1>
|
|
|
|
<p>Users will see your service name:</p>
|
|
<ul class="list-bullet">
|
|
<li>at the start of every text message, eg 'Vehicle tax: we received your payment, thank you'</li>
|
|
<li>as your email sender name</li>
|
|
</ul>
|
|
|
|
<form autocomplete="off" action="" method="post">
|
|
{{ form.hidden_tag() }}
|
|
{{ render_field(form.service_name, class='form-control-2-3') }}
|
|
|
|
<p>
|
|
<button class="button" href="dashboard" role="button">Continue</button>
|
|
</p>
|
|
</form>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
|
|
{% endblock %}
|